With these CVCe word worksheets, students will practice reading, writing and spelling AGE words. These worksheets practice the magic E or silent E spelling rule. These worksheets allow students to practice reading AGE words in the context of a sentence or story, as well as in isolation. This product is suitable for kindergartners and first graders who are learning about how to read and spell CVCe words. There are a number of different worksheets included for students to work on this spelling rule as well as alphabetical order, matching and reading comprehension. Worksheets included: Write the Word - write the correct AGE word under each picture Spell and Write - color each dot to spell each word then write the word on the line provided Match the Picture - read the word then circle the correct picture Match the Word - look at the picture and circle the correct word CVCe Sentences - read the sentences and write the correct word to fill in the blanks CVCe Stamp It - use stamps to spell each word CVCe Cut and Paste - use magazine letter cut outs to spell each word What am I? - write the word under each picture CVCe Story - read each story and write each AGE word that you find in the story When to Use Early Finishers - When students finish their work, they can complete these cut and paste activities while waiting on their classmates to finish their assignments. Homework – These worksheets are great to send home for students to work with parents. Small Group Activity - The teacher can pull aside a small group of students who need more practice with this skill to use these worksheets with. Independent practice - Students can work on these worksheets alone at their desks. Sub Plans - The no-prep nature of these worksheets make them perfect to include in sub plans. Each worksheet is no prep. They just need to print out the worksheets and give to students to complete. Some sheets will require extra materials like scissors and glue, or stamps. These worksheets will keep student engaged as they read, write, spell and recognize words that use the magic E or silent E spellings. Skills Assessed Reading, Writing, Spelling CVCe Words

BENEFITS FOR CHILDREN OF CUTTING FIGURES: - It will help develop fine motor skills: Cutting out figures will help strengthen the muscles of the fingers and hands, thus improving the dexterity and control necessary for children to later write and carry out other activities that require fine lines. - It will strengthen hand-eye coordination: When cutting , children must coordinate their hand-eye to make the precise cut. - It will promote their concentration skills: Cutting will require the child to concentrate and be attentive, which will help them improve their ability to focus on a task for prolonged periods.
